The Perfect Family
What is a perfect family?
Do they exist?
One who never fights - always listens
Accepts each others flaws.
Is it real?
Could it be?
Kids never fight,
Mom never yells.
Dark secrets and lies
Shoved under the rug.
Fake smiles
Plastered on their faces-
As they pose for
their annual Christmas card.
A perfect family
Happily unhappy.
